WHY PARABEN FREE?

Parabens are a group of cosmetics preservatives, including butylparaben, propylparaben, methylparaben, and ethylparaben. It is estimated that more than 90% of all cosmetic products contain some form of paraben. Research showed evidence of a weak estrogen effect on cells in a way that could be problematic for binding to receptor sites that may cause proliferation of MCF-7 breast cancer cells. (Source: Journal of Steroid Biochemistry and Molecular Biology, January 2002, pgs 49–60)

 

 

KEY INGREDIENTS

Mica is a transparent mineral which is mined from the earth. It can be opalescent and sparkling or completely matte, ranging in color from grey to blue to green. It is often treated with iron oxides to yield brilliant color effects.
Iron Oxides are natural oxides of iron that is combined with oxygen, varying in color from red to brown, black to orange or yellow, depending on the degree of water added. Titanium Dioxide is an inert earth mineral used as a thickening, whitening, lubricating, and sunscreen ingredient in cosmetics. It protects skin from UVA and UVB radiation and is considered to have no risk of skin irritation.
